1. Templeton Global Income Fund (GIM) - Dividend Yield: 9.5%

Franklin Resources, Inc. launched Templeton Global Income Fund, a mutual fund that provides fixed-income income. Franklin Advisers, Inc. manages the fund. It invests in fixed-income markets around the world. The fund mainly invests in bonds of the government. It is managed actively. The fund benchmarks its performance against the J.P. Morgan Global Government Bond Index. Templeton Global Income Fund, which was established March 17, 1988, is based in the United States.

2. Educational Development Corporation (EDUC) - Dividend Yield: 9.17%

Educational Development Corporation is a publisher company that acts as a trade-co-publisher for educational books for children in the United States. It offers a variety of books including activity and flashcard books, touchy-feely boards, book and sticker books, search and adventure books, stickers and books for foreign languages, science and math, chapter books, novels, and books that can be used as point and finger books. The company operates under two distinct divisions: Publishing and Home Business. Home Business distributes books via a network independent consultants. This includes direct sales, home parties and book fairs. It also uses social media to promote the brand through online platforms. Books are sold to booksellers in bookstores, specialty shops, museums and other outlets across the country by The Publishing division. This company distributes Usborne Publishing Limited's children's book. Educational Development Corporation was established in 1965. It is located in Tulsa in Oklahoma.

3. Alliance Resource Partners, L.P. (ARLP) - Dividend Yield: 8.2%

Alliance Resource Partners L.P. is a multi-faceted natural resource company that produces and markets coal to major utilities in the United States. It operates in three areas: Appalachia Basin, Minerals, and Appalachia. The company produces various types of thermal and metallic coal, with heat and sulfur content. It also operates underground mines in Illinois and Indiana as well as Kentucky, Maryland, Maryland, West Virginia, and Kentucky. It also leases land on Mt. Ohio and runs a coal loading dock there. Vernon, Indiana. It buys and sells coal and also owns interest in several oil and gas mineral rights located in producing basins of the United States. The company also offers a variety of industrial and mining technology products, including proximity detection systems and miner equipment tracking systems. It had 1.65 billion tonnes of coal reserves proven or probable in Illinois, Indiana Kentucky Maryland Pennsylvania and West Virginia as of December 31, 2020. 4. Orix Corp (IX) - Dividend Yield: 4.3%

ORIX Corporation offers diversified financial services throughout Japan, Asia, Europe and Australasia. Corporate Financial Services offers loans, leasing, leasing and leasing for small and medium enterprises. The Maintenance Leasing segment deals in leasing, car rental and vehicle sharing. It also rents precision measuring and information technology-related equipment and robots. Software packages are sold, calibrations and asset management activities are performed. Technical support is provided, including vehicle maintenance outsourcing and tailored services for individual and corporate clients. Real Estate is the company's segment. It develops and rents commercial property, residential properties and logistics centers; it also operates accommodation, tanks, training facilities and baseball stadiums. The Real Estate segment offers investment and rental management services, as well as REIT and advisory services in real estate. The company's Investment and Operation section deals with the disposal and collection of end-of lease assets, environment and energy management and investments in geothermal power and wind power. Its retail segment provides life insurance and banking products as well as card loans and other services. The company's Overseas Business section is engaged in financing, leasing, management, investment and intermediary activities. It also deals in corporate finance, securities investments, private equity and loan origination. The original name of the company was Orient Leasing Co., Ltd., but it changed its name in 1989 to ORIX Corporation. It was founded in Tokyo in 1950.

5. Nuveen New York Select Tax (NXN) - Dividend Yield: 3.34%

Nuveen Investments Inc. launched Nuveen New York Select tax-free Income Portfolio, a closed-ended mutual fund that provides fixed income. Nuveen Asset Management, LLC and Nuveen Fund Advisors LLC co-manage the fund. The fund invests in New York's fixed-income markets. It invests in securities from companies operating across diverse sectors. The fund invests primarily in municipal bonds that have a credit quality above BBB/BAA. To create its portfolio, the fund uses fundamental analysis. The fund benchmarks its portfolio's performance against the Barclays Capital New York Municipal Bond Index or S&P New York Municipal Bond Index. Nuveen New York Select tax-free income portfolio was established on June 19, 1992. It is based in the United States.
